Human Rights in China and the United States, with Carroll Bogert

Carroll Bogert (AB ’83, AM ’86) is president of The Marshall Project and previously deputy executive director at Human Rights Watch. Before joining Human Rights Watch in 1998, she spent twelve years as a foreign correspondent for Newsweek in China, Southeast Asia, and the Soviet Union.

She was awarded the 2019 Centennial Medal Citation by Harvard’s Graduate School of Arts and Sciences, the highest honor bestowed by the school to alumni in recognition of outstanding contributions to society.
